OBJECTIVES: Group A rotavirus is a major cause of acute gastroenteritis in young children worldwide. A prospective surveillance network has been set up in France to investigate rotavirus infections and to detect the emergence of potentially epidemic strains. METHODS: From 2014 to 2017, rotavirus-positive stool samples were collected from 2394 children under 5 years old attending the paediatric emergency units of 13 large hospitals. Rotaviruses were genotyped by RT-PCR with regard to their outer capsid proteins VP4 and VP7. RESULTS: Genotyping of 2421 rotaviruses showed that after a marked increase in G9P[8] (32.1%) during the 2014-2015 season, G9P[8] became the predominant genotype during the 2015-2016 and 2016-2017 seasons with detection rates of 64.1% and 77.3%, respectively, whereas G1P[8] were detected at low rates of 16.8% and 6.6%, respectively. Phylogenetic analysis of the partial rotavirus VP7 and VP4 coding genes revealed that all of these G9P [8] strains belonged to the lineage III and the P [8]-3 lineage, respectively, and shared the same genetic background (G9-P[8]-I1-R1-C1-M1-A1-N1-T1-E1-H1) as did most of previously detected G9P[8] strains and particularly the emerging G9P[8] strains from the 2004-2005 season in France. CONCLUSIONS: G9P[8] rotaviruses have become the predominant circulating genotype for the first time since their emergence a decade ago. In the absence of rotavirus immunization programmes in France, our data give an insight into the natural fluctuation of rotavirus genotypes in a non-vaccinated population and provide a base line for a better interpretation of data in European countries with routine rotavirus vaccination.

In the framework of the European BIOTECH project for sequencing the Saccharomyces cerevisiae genome, we have determined the nucleotide sequence of the left part of the cosmid clone 232 and the cosmid clone 233 provided by F. Galibert (Rennes Cedex, France). We present here 33,099 base pairs of sequence derived from the left arm of chromosome X of strain S288C. This sequence reveals 17 open reading frames (ORFs) with more than 299 base pairs, including the published sequences for ARG3, LIGTR/LIG1, ORF2, ACT3 and SCP160. Two other ORFs showed similarity with S. cerevisiae genes: one with the CAN1 gene coding for an arginine permease, and one with genes encoding the family of transcriptional activators containing a fungal Zn(II)2-Cys6 binuclear cluster domain like that found in Ppr1p or Ga14p. Both putative proteins contain a leucine zipper motif, the Can1p homologue has 12 putative membrane-spanning domains and a putative alpha 2-SCB-alpha 2 binding site. In a diploid disruption mutant of ORF J0922 coding for the transcriptional activator homologue, no colonies appeared before 10 days after transformation and then grew slowly. In contrast, haploid disruption mutants showed a growth phenotype like wild-type cells. One ORF showed weak similarity to the rad4 gene product of Schizosaccharomyces pombe and is essential for yeast growth. Five ORFs showed similarity to putative genes on the right arm of chromosome XI of S. cerevisiae. Body effusions from 197 cats and blood serum samples from 252 cats, where Feline Infectious Peritonitis (FIP) was part of the differential diagnosis, were analysed. The diagnoses were confirmed by clinical follow up or histopathology. The final diagnosis FIP was always confirmed by histopathology. The median age of cats with FIP was 1.6 years. FIP was responsible for 41% of the body effusions, whereas malignomas caused 24%, cardial insufficiencies 14% and purulent serositis 12% of the body effusions. The rivalta test was highly sensitive for FIP. Predictive value of a negative result was 100%, predictive value of a positive result was 84%. In half of the cases with purulent serositis and in 20% of malignomas rivalta reacted positive. The cardial insufficiencies were negative for rivalta. Coronavirus antigen could be demonstrated by immunofluorescence in 34 of 49 body effusions caused by FIP, whereas in the 50 body effusions caused by other diseases no coronavirus antigen was detected. An albumin globulin ratio of < 0.6 was highly diagnostic for an inflammatory process, nearly exclusively for FIP. An albumin globulin ratio of > or = 0.8 almost excluded FIP. Only a negative or very high (1:1600) FIP titer could contribute to confirm diagnosis. Low and medium titers, however, should not be interpreted.

It is unclear whether malocclusion characterized by jaw discrepancy is caused by variations in mandibular position, mandibular size, or a combination of the two. To clarify the situation, the mandibular outlines of 124 10-year-old boys, equally divided among the Angle classes, were generated from cephalograms with a computer plotting technique. The mean plots for each of the groups were superimposed on S-N and Go-Gn. These showed mandibular form and size to be similar in the Class I and Class III groups and in both divisions of Class II. The position of Class III mandibles was more anterior and rotated forward in relation to the cranial base compared with the other groups. Statistical analysis confirmed these findings. There was evidence to support the idea that Class II, Division 2 malocclusion is largely a dentoalveolar rather than a skeletal entity.

The design and characteristics of an optical filter using a holographic grating in combination with a multiple entrance and exit slit arrangement are described. The instrument transmits VUV radiation at Ar(I) 106.6 nm and Kr(I) 123.6 nm while excluding the hydrogen Lyman-alpha at 121.6 nm. The transmission at 123.6 nm is approximately 10%, if averaged over the circular entrance aperture of 28-mm diameter without correcting for the blocking by the masks. The corresponding transmission at 121.6 nm is 0.0001 or less. The concept with selective blocking of one wavelength and transmission at another using a multiple slit arrangement is transferable to any line pair. The 123.6-nm grating efficiency has been assessed as 37%.

In CF1 mice lindane treatment led to a significant increase in liver tumor incidence whilst in Osborne-Mendel rats it was not carcinogenic. Although somewhat less clear, the test in B6C3F1 mice led to the conclusion that under the conditions of the bioassay lindane was not carcinogenic for this strain. In this study, the specific activities of some enzymes which are thought to be involved in the metabolism of lindane were studied in these different strains in order to investigate whether differences exist in the activities of these enzymes. Because the enzyme pattern may change after lindane treatment during the carcinogenicity studies, we also investigated the enzyme activities in animals treated for 3 days or 3 months with various doses of lindane. The influence of lindane treatment on the relative liver weight was also determined. B6C3F1 mice showed no increase in absolute or relative liver weight even after 3 months of treatment with the highest tolerated dose of lindane. However, in the susceptible CF1 strain lindane led to a large increase of the absolute and relative liver weight in both sexes, whilst a smaller increase was observed in Osborne-Mendel rats. Basal glutathione-S-transferase activity was higher in males than in females in all three strains, bearing no apparent relationship to susceptibility for tumor formation. However, after treatment with the highest dose of lindane a 5-6-fold induction of this enzyme activity was observed in female CF1 mice, which then together with the male CF1 mice had a higher glutathione-S-transferase activity than untreated and treated B6C3F1 mice and Osborne-Mendel rats. Whether lindane or one of its metabolites is activated by conjugation with glutathione remains to be established. After treatment of the animals with high doses of lindane detergent-treated rat liver microsomes showed a higher UDP-glucuronosyltransferase activity than mouse liver microsomes. This high activity could lead to a rapid conjugation of phenols derived from lindane. The most striking difference observed in this study was the fact that together with the larger increase in absolute and relative liver weight, untreated and treated CF1 mice showed higher monooxygenase activity and, after treatment with lindane, lower epoxide hydrolase activity than rats. Whether the high monooxygenase and rather low epoxide hydrolase activity will lead to an accumulation of reactive epoxides derived from lindane remains to be clarified.
